From 1a427ab0c1b205d1bda8da0b77ea9d295ac23c57 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Dave Chinner Date: Thu, 16 Dec 2010 17:08:41 +1100 Subject: xfs: convert pag_ici_lock to a spin lock now that we are using RCU protection for the inode cache lookups, the lock is only needed on the modification side. Hence it is not necessary for the lock to be a rwlock as there are no read side holders anymore. Convert it to a spin lock to reflect it's exclusive nature.
